On TP-Link Tapo C260 v1 and D235 v1, a guest‑level authenticated user can bypass intended access restrictions by sending crafted requests to a synchronization endpoint. This allows modification of protected device settings despite limited privileges. An attacker may change sensitive configuration parameters without authorization, resulting in unauthorized device state manipulation but not full code execution.

A vertical privilege escalation vulnerability in TP-Link Tapo C260 v1 and D235 v1 allows guest-level authenticated users to bypass access controls on a synchronization endpoint. By sending crafted requests, attackers can modify protected device settings that should require higher privileges, enabling unauthorized device state manipulation without achieving full code execution.

MitigationApply vendor firmware updates from TP-Link when available; until then, restrict guest-level account access and monitor for unauthorized configuration changes.

Am I affected? How to checkSteps we derive from the advisory and the affected-version data, so you can decide whether this CVE reaches your setup. They are a guide, not a scan — your own configuration is the authority.

dbcve checks

Work through these to decide whether this CVE applies to you.

  1. Identify device model
    Access the TP-Link Tapo app or device web interface to confirm the exact model number is Tapo C260 v1 or D235 v1
    Affected if Device is a Tapo C260 v1 or D235 v1
  2. Check firmware version
    In the Tapo app, go to Device Settings > Device Info to view the current firmware version. For C260, compare against 1.1.9
    Affected if Firmware version is below 1.1.9 for C260 (version range for D235 not specified)
  3. Verify guest account status
    In the Tapo app, check Device Settings > Guest Network or account management to see if guest-level accounts are enabled
    Affected if Guest accounts are enabled and active on the device
  4. Audit recent configuration changes
    Review device logs or configuration history for unexpected changes to protected settings (such as network configuration, motion detection settings, or automation rules) that were not made by an admin account
    Affected if Configuration changes exist that were not initiated by an administrator-level account

The device is affected if it is a Tapo C260 v1 (firmware below 1.1.9) or D235 v1 with guest accounts enabled, and unauthorized configuration changes are present in the logs.
